Why do golfers buy new clubs?

This is a question with multiple answers, and many of them are inherently funny. The truth is, many golfers believe new clubs will magically improve their game. It's a common misconception that a new driver will instantly solve a slice, or a new set of irons will catapult scores down. The reality is often far more nuanced; better equipment can help, but ultimately, the golfer's skill and practice are the true determining factors. The humor lies in this gap between expectation and reality – the endless quest for the perfect club, a quest often fueled by clever marketing and the golfer’s own hopes and dreams.

What are some funny golf quotes about specific clubs?

Many of the funniest quotes target specific clubs. The driver, often the source of both powerful drives and embarrassing shanks, is a frequent target. The putter, responsible for the final, crucial stroke, is another common victim of humorous jabs. Many of these jokes highlight the delicate balance of precision and luck involved in each shot.

Here are a few examples (remember, humor is subjective!):

  • "I've got a driver that's so powerful, it hits the ball before I do!" – This highlights the golfer's struggle to control their powerful equipment.
  • "My putter thinks it's a back scratcher." – This paints a humorous picture of a frustratingly inconsistent putter.
  • "My irons are so inconsistent, they're practically random number generators." – This encapsulates the unpredictable nature of badly-behaving irons.
